Economic Releases 

9:00 am EST

  • The FHFA House Price Index MoM for July is estimated to fall -.2% versus a -.2% decline in June.
  • The S&P Cotality CS 20-City MoM SA for July is estimated to fall -.2% versus a -.25% decline in June. 

9:45 am EST

  • The MNI Chicago PMI for Sept. is estimated to rise to 43.5 versus 41.5 in Aug. 

10:00 am EST

  • The JOLTS Job Openings for Aug. is estimated to rise to 7200K versus 7181K in July.
  • Conference Board Consumer Confidence for Sept. is estimated to fall to 96.0 versus 97.4 in Aug.
